Background Information:

Going with the flow is something we're all guilty of. Even the meanest of people can find themselves doing the things they do because they don't know how else to handle a situation. An inside look at how Babs might've been thinking throughout her first trip to Ponyville, and why she acted the way she did.

Notes:

I really wanted to get deep into the thoughts of bullies or just mean people in general. Sure, some of them are just assholes, but not all of them. Growing up in a relatively good neighborhood and being in the Gifted and Talented program, I was always sheltered and never really experienced any long term bullying. Of course there were times, but I made friends with pretty much everyone that I was ever at odds with (except for one nasty dude) due to my (it will sound like I'm bragging lol) flexible personality and understanding why people act the way they do. Even with that nasty dude, I learned that he had a situation at home and eventually just stopped interacting with him. My sister on the other hand experienced extreme bullying and had to transfer schools because of it, and I couldn't understand why she had so much trouble fitting in and making friends. Eventually, instead of teaching her how to make friends, I instead told her about how different people have different perspectives and situations that she may not know or agree with, and how to diffuse things if it ever got out of hand. Apparently it helped because instead of being bullied, now my sister is a rather popular girl who has lots of friends.

Long story short, keep an open mind about people, even if first impressions are bad.
